Let's start with a simple, unsettling idea: the things that make us sick aren't just cigarettes over here and soda over there. They're a family of products—ultra-processed foods, soft drinks, tobacco, and alcohol—built and pushed by the same global machinery. And that machinery is really good at what it does. Stuckler, McKee, Ebrahim, and Basu put it bluntly: these are manufactured epidemics. The striking twist is where they're growing. Not in the rich countries you might expect, but fastest in low- and middle-income countries, where budgets are tight, markets are opening, and companies see the future. Why stitch these products together? Because they move together. They share shelf-stable formulas, cheap inputs, and huge margins—on the order of a quarter of the retail price for items like soft drinks and tobacco. They travel on the same trade agreements, the same foreign direct investment pipelines, and the same ad campaigns. And when barriers fall, they flood in. That's the big frame. Now, how do we know? The team grounded their story in market sales, not self-reported diets. They tapped EuroMonitor's Passport database, which tracks per-capita sales of packaged foods, soft drinks, alcohol, and tobacco in up to eighty countries from 1997 to 2010, with forecasts to 2016. Think of it as a cash-register view of the food and beverage world. It's not perfect—sales aren't the same as intake; waste and informal markets get missed—but for comparing countries over time, these data are stable. To make apples-to-apples comparisons, they analyzed volumes and sales at constant 2011 prices and fixed exchange rates. They asked two questions. First, where is consumption rising fastest? Second, what's driving those increases? And they answered them with a population lens, channeling Geoffrey Rose's reminder that to understand why whole populations get sick, you look at the big forces—income, urbanization, and market integration—more than individual choices. On the "where" question, the pattern is hard to miss. Growth in snacks, soft drinks, and processed foods is fastest in low- and middle-income countries. In high-income countries, the curve has flattened out, with little or no growth projected over the following five years. Keep the tape rolling forward and you see convergence: if recent trajectories hold, low- and middle-income countries, or LMICs, could reach current high-income consumption levels for these foods within about three decades. And because LMIC populations are more than five times larger, most of the world's soft drinks, salty snacks, and ready meals are already being, and will continue to be, consumed there. Tobacco and alcohol follow the same road, just at a slower speed. In LMICs, they were projected to rise by roughly twenty percent over five years, with about four decades to catch up to then-current rich-country levels, while many rich countries were inching down, helped along by the post-2008 recession. Zoom in and you see the market footprints that make this possible. Multinationals are everywhere. In Brazil, Nestlé holds about eight point four percent of the packaged-food market—an eye-catching single-firm share for a sprawling sector. In Mexico, PepsiCo and Nestlé are at five point three and three point eight percent, respectively, both sitting near the top. Across LMICs, at least one multinational was among the top two manufacturers in every country they analyzed, with China the big exception. In the United States, the familiar giants—Kraft, PepsiCo, and Nestlé—sit on top too, but the striking thing is how similar the competitive picture has become across income levels. It's not a local bodega story. It's a global distribution and branding story. Now, if you track the products over time, some countries jump off the page. Vietnam and India were on track to double soft drink consumption per person. Egypt, China, Tunisia, Cameroon, and Morocco were set to grow by about fifty percent in soft drinks or processed foods, in some cases posting double-digit increases year after year. And then there's Mexico, the outlier: more than three hundred liters of soft drinks per person annually and one of the highest child obesity rates in the developing world—over thirty percent. For its level of income, that's off the curve. It tells you that policy and market structure can bend the line. Here's a deeper clue: when the authors linked the markets together, they found a tight bundle. Countries that were high in tobacco and alcohol sales also tended to be high in soft drinks and processed foods. Across eighty countries in 2010, the correlation among these four categories was about zero point seventy-nine—very strong—while staples like oils and fats didn't move with the pack at all. That's important. It suggests the driver isn't just "more money, more calories." It's the shared regulatory and marketing environment. And yes, rising income matters too. In the cross-sections, gross domestic product, or GDP, per capita was moderately to strongly associated with soft drinks, snacks, and processed foods—soft drinks around zero point fifty-nine, snacks closer to zero point seventy-one. But the story gets more interesting when you add the role of global capital. On the "why" question, two forces stand out: income and market integration. The authors built a set of panel models for fifty LMICs, using World Bank indicators to track GDP per capita, the share of the population living in cities, and foreign direct investment, or FDI, as a share of GDP. Methodologically this is pretty standard, but solid: multiple categories, robust clustered errors to account for repeated country observations, outcomes measured in per-capita volumes or sales. The results? Rising income is consistently associated with higher per-capita sales across almost all categories—alcohol, tobacco, packaged foods, processed foods, soft drinks, confections, and ice cream. The models aren't explaining everything, but they explain a lot, with R squared values ranging from roughly zero point twenty-two up to about zero point fifty-one depending on the category, strongest for processed foods and soft drinks. Urbanization surprised them. The old story says "more cities, more fast food." Here, once you control for income and integration, urbanization mostly drops out. The exception is soft drinks, where urban living still carries some weight. The heavyweight variable turns out to be FDI. Where foreign direct investment is higher—think bottling plants, distribution hubs, big-box retail—exposure to soft drinks, processed foods, and alcohol is higher, full stop. And FDI doesn't just add its own effect; it changes what income does. When FDI is under about two percent of GDP, the link between rising GDP and more consumption essentially disappears for things like confections, ice cream, processed foods, packaged foods, even tobacco. When FDI is above that threshold, the GDP-consumption link switches on and strengthens, especially for soft drinks. Put plainly: money only turns into market penetration when there's a pipeline to pour products through. Trade policy shows up the same way. In countries with free-trade agreements with the United States, per-capita soft drink consumption sits about sixty-three percent higher than in comparable countries without those agreements, even after adjusting for income and urbanization. The confidence interval is wide—roughly twenty-four to one hundred three percent—but the direction is clear. If you open the door wide for beverages, beverages walk in. If you want proof that rules matter, look at the policy case studies they sketch. After Mexico opened its market through a U.S. trade deal in the nineteen nineties, soft drink sales surged alongside a visible wave of multinational entry. Venezuela, without that agreement, saw steadier consumption despite economic growth. Tobacco shows the mirror image: Brazil's late nineteen nineties push—price hikes, public bans, strong controls even before the global Framework Convention on Tobacco Control—coincided with a sharp fall in tobacco consumption, on the order of a seventy-five percent drop between nineteen ninety-eight and two thousand three, and low levels thereafter. Chile, which implemented strict tobacco controls later, experienced rising use in the interim. And in high-income Europe, the United Kingdom's deregulated retail landscape—cheaper alcohol in giant supermarkets, easier access—has coincided with higher per-capita alcohol consumption than France by roughly thirty percent. Same population? No. Same products? Largely. Different rules? Definitely. One more link ties this market story back to health. Where countries consume more of these unhealthy commodities, obesity and diabetes rates tend to be higher. The paper is careful here: these are population-level associations, not a clean causal arrow. Still, obesity shows up as a leading indicator of exposure to this cluster of products, which is exactly what you'd expect if environments are shifting. Let's be honest about the limitations. Sales volumes aren't bites and sips. They miss what's wasted, what's homemade, and what's smuggled. Informal stalls and nonretail channels are undercounted. Forecasts are forecasts. But the consistency of the cross-country patterns, the convergence by income level, the strength of the clustering, and the way FDI and trade crack open markets—all of that hangs together. So what do we do with this? The lesson from tobacco still applies: prices and availability matter enormously. Raising prices through taxes, limiting access through licensing and retail rules—these are blunt tools, but they're effective and cheap. In settings where supermarkets and beverage aisles have raced ahead of regulation, dialing back the ease and ubiquity of purchase can slow the curve. Trade and investment rules are less visible but just as powerful. As Stuckler and colleagues point out, how you design a trade agreement shows up later in what's on the shelf and what people drink. That sixty-three percent bump tied to U.S. agreements isn't a footnote; it's a nutrition policy hiding in a commerce document. Market power matters too. When a handful of firms control large shares of shelf space, their promotions and pricing shape what's "normal." The authors call for better surveillance of concentration—who owns how much of the retail floor—as well as stronger conflict-of-interest rules so health policy isn't captured by the companies it's supposed to constrain. And they argue for marketing restrictions and availability limits that focus where vulnerability is highest, including urban-poor neighborhoods where cheap calories crowd out healthier staples. Underneath all this is that paradox we started with. Poverty can raise risk, not because people suddenly crave soda, but because cheap, aggressively marketed products meet loosened rules and rising distribution capacity. Wealth growth without guardrails doesn't automatically deliver healthier diets; it delivers whatever the most profitable supply chain can sell. If you're a data person, you may be itching for more. So are the authors. They want finer-grained measures of retail-sector foreign direct investment, the guts of trade agreements—tariffs, quotas, non-tariff barriers—better tracking of market concentration, and better data on the availability and price of healthier alternatives. Those aren't academic wish lists; they're the instruments that would let us tell whether policy is working and where the next push will come from. Let me end on a sober optimism. None of this is destiny. The same levers that sped these products into low- and middle-income countries—investment rules, trade terms, taxes, placement, promotion—can be pulled in the other direction. Brazil's tobacco turnaround shows it. So does the softening of alcohol use where pricing and access have tightened. The global food system is complex, but it isn't a black box. It's a set of incentives and channels. And as Stuckler and colleagues remind us, if we want different outcomes, we need to change the channels through which money becomes markets, and markets become meals.
